## TideLine Widget — Release Notes for RM

TideLine is the embeddable tide-table widget shipped to coastal partner sites. Releases go out weekly; data refreshes are separate and automatic. Your job as release manager: cut the tag, run the bundle build, and verify the harbor fixtures render for Port Averil and Graysholm.

The bundle must be signed before the CDN publisher accepts it. Add the current deploy key to your signing config, shown here.

signing key of hahap-hagug = bky4_7yKj

## Bulk Edits — TableForge Admin

Plugin authors: bulk edits in the TableForge admin grid run through the batch mutation endpoint, not per-row hooks. Your plugin receives one `batchApply` call with the full selection. Do not iterate rows yourself; the engine handles chunking and rollback.

Validation runs once per batch. If any row fails, the whole batch reverts — design your validators accordingly.

All plugin bundles must be signed before the marketplace accepts them. Sign against the current release key, shown below.

rollout seal: bky4_HEH9

## Authentication

The FareBand pricing experiment calls the internal QuoteMix service. One key, read/write on experiment buckets only. Rotation is monthly; on-call does not rotate manually. If QuoteMix returns 401, check the key before paging the platform team. Prod key lives in the vault under `fareband/quotemix`. For the staging environment, use the key below.

service key, tadup-tahog: zpat7_wB1tnEL

Quick recap for sales leads: with roughly 40% of Quillbrook Trading's revenue now coming from the Marovian market, the swings in exchange rates were eating noticeably into margins. Finance has decided to hedge about two-thirds of expected receipts for the next four quarters using forward contracts. Short version for you: quoted prices in Marovian deals are now locked for longer, so fewer mid-quarter repricing headaches. Pricing sheets update next week. There's one confidential piece attached to this decision, set out just below.

confidential, kajof-tahof: The pricing group signed off on a budget of $491.8 million for Project Casvan.